Transaction 3dd6e0bd409bbafce6af6fefbc5505a41962da9cfab6320cbd9e66cfae5e6761
1 Input
1 Output
-
3dd6e0bd409bbafce6af6fefbc5505a41962da9cfab6320cbd9e66cfae5e6761:0
- value
- 135220887
- script pubkey
- OP_0 OP_PUSHBYTES_20 31c7e328907631dd92a7a41d3083359465f924a6
- address
- bc1qx8r7x2yswccamy485swnpqe4j3jljf9xrnej0e